Pentagon accuses Alibaba, BYD of aiding Chinese military
Summary
The U.S. Department of Defense has banned Alibaba, BYD, and Baidu from receiving U.S. defense contracts. These companies were added to a list of Chinese firms believed to support the Chinese military, even though they are not part of traditional defense industries.Key Facts
- The Pentagon updated its list of Chinese companies linked to the Chinese military.
- Alibaba, a major tech company, is now on this list.
- BYD, an electric vehicle maker from China, was also added.
- Baidu, a Chinese search engine company, is included as well.
- These companies are not state-owned but are considered to help the Chinese military.
- Being on this list stops them from getting contracts with the U.S. Defense Department.
- This action is part of U.S. efforts to limit military ties with Chinese businesses.
